**Ticket DE-887: Signature verification failed on Sketchline 2.4 build**

The Sketchline 2.4 release candidate, which includes the new branching undo/redo history, failed signature verification in CI. The artifact appears fine; the verifier is likely using a stale key from before last month's rotation. Please review the verification step and confirm it references the current key shown below.

release key, fafof-kahog: bky4_hWtU

- [ ] Step 7: Archive cold storage buckets (Glacierline tier). Confirm both ceremony witnesses are present, verify bucket manifests match the Oxbow ledger, then seal the archive key shares. Plugin authors may observe but not handle shares. Once sealed, the archive index itself is encrypted and can only be reopened with the passphrase below.

vault phrase of badup-hahig = tamael-aldael-kelmir-istael-fenok-istwyn-tamius-jorath-oliion

Subject: Partner SFTP drop — new owner

Hi,

As you review the pending changes to the Harborline ingest scripts, note that ownership of the partner SFTP drop is changing at the end of the month. This includes key rotation, the nightly pull job, and the quarantine folder for malformed files. Review comments on the retry logic should still go through the normal PR flow, but questions about drop-folder conventions or partner onboarding now go to the new owner. The incoming owner is listed below.

signatory, tagaf-bahaf: Praael Fenmir Rusok

Handing off the Quillbus broker upgrade (4.x to 5.1) to Dario. Cluster is half-migrated; mixed-version mode is supported but TLS cert rotation must finish before cutover. No auth model changes, though the admin API gained two new endpoints worth reviewing. Open questions and the migration checklist are tracked on the internal page below.

dashboard of taduf-bawef = https://jira.lumicsys.internal/projects/display/browse/b1cbf89d